1. Superhuman โ Best for High-Volume Power Users
Superhuman remains the gold standard for inbox speed. The AI layer added over the past 18 months means it now does more than keyboard shortcuts: it drafts full replies from a single bullet point, summarizes threads you missed, and highlights action items across conversations.
| Feature | Detail |
|---|---|
| AI reply drafts | From bullet points or natural language |
| Thread summary | Any thread, one click |
| Follow-up reminders | Snooze + AI-suggested timing |
| Triage | Priority split inbox |
| Pricing | $30/month per user |
| Best for | Founders, sales, executives with 100+ emails/day |
Key differentiator: Split inbox keeps AI-flagged important messages separate from newsletters, notifications, and CC chains โ so your real work is always visible.
2. Shortwave โ Best AI-Native Gmail Client
Shortwave was built from scratch as an AI-first email client. Unlike tools that bolt AI onto an existing client, every Shortwave feature assumes AI is in the loop. Threads are auto-grouped, summaries appear before you open messages, and the assistant can answer questions about your inbox history.
| Feature | Detail |
|---|---|
| Auto-grouping | Threads by topic, not just sender |
| Pre-read summaries | Displayed before opening |
| Inbox Q&A | "What did Sarah say about the contract?" |
| Draft assistant | Multi-step prompts for complex replies |
| Pricing | Free (limited AI); Pro from $9/month |
| Best for | Gmail users who want a full AI-native experience |
Standout feature: The inbox Q&A is genuinely useful โ ask "What is the status of the Acme renewal?" and get a synthesized answer from your actual email history.
3. SaneBox โ Best for Passive Inbox Triage
SaneBox takes a different approach: it does not replace your email client, it runs alongside it. SaneBox trains on your behavior to automatically move low-priority mail into folders like @SaneLater and @SaneBlackHole, leaving only genuinely important mail in your inbox.
| Feature | Detail |
|---|---|
| Works with | Any IMAP inbox (Gmail, Outlook, iCloud, Fastmail) |
| Training | Learns from your existing behavior |
| SaneBlackHole | Unsubscribe by dragging |
| SaneReminders | Follow-up if no reply in X days |
| Pricing | From $7/month |
| Best for | Anyone overwhelmed by inbox volume without switching clients |
Why it works: No setup required beyond OAuth authorization. SaneBox starts sorting within 24 hours and improves accuracy over weeks.
4. Microsoft Copilot for Outlook โ Best for Microsoft 365 Teams
If your organization is on Microsoft 365, Copilot for Outlook is already available (with the right license tier) and deeply integrated. It summarizes email threads, drafts replies in your tone, and surfaces action items from your entire mailbox โ not just the current thread.
| Feature | Detail |
|---|---|
| Thread summary | Full chain including attachments |
| Draft generation | Tone-aware, length-adjustable |
| Action item extraction | From any email or thread |
| Calendar integration | Draft meeting invites from email context |
| Pricing | Included in Microsoft 365 Copilot ($30/user/month add-on) |
| Best for | Enterprise orgs already on Microsoft 365 |
Limitation: The $30/user/month Copilot add-on is expensive at scale. For small teams, individual tools like Shortwave or Superhuman are more cost-effective.
5. Missive โ Best for Team Email Collaboration
Missive is a shared inbox platform with built-in AI. Teams can collaborate on email replies in real time โ like a Google Doc inside an email thread โ with AI drafting, translation, and tone adjustment available to every team member. Ideal for customer support, sales, and account management teams that share an inbox.
| Feature | Detail |
|---|---|
| Shared inbox | Multiple users, one inbox |
| AI drafts | Context from full thread history |
| Translation | 50+ languages in-line |
| Internal comments | Beside email thread, not sent to recipient |
| Integrations | Slack, Salesforce, HubSpot, Pipedrive |
| Pricing | From $14/user/month |
| Best for | Customer support, sales teams, agencies |
Key feature: Internal comments in the thread view mean your team can discuss a reply strategy without forwarding the email or switching to Slack.
Side-by-Side Comparison
| Tool | Works With | AI Strength | Price/Month |
|---|---|---|---|
| Superhuman | Gmail, Outlook | Speed + drafts | $30/user |
| Shortwave | Gmail | AI-native experience | Free / $9 |
| SaneBox | Any IMAP | Passive triage | $7+ |
| Copilot for Outlook | Outlook / M365 | Deep integration | $30 add-on |
| Missive | Gmail, Outlook, IMAP | Team collaboration | $14/user |
How to Choose
- High personal email volume + Gmail โ Superhuman or Shortwave
- Want AI without changing your client โ SaneBox
- Microsoft 365 organization โ Copilot for Outlook
- Shared team inbox โ Missive
- Budget-first โ Shortwave (free tier) or SaneBox ($7)
